Kicking over traces is a phrase used to describe someone who defies the rules or goes against what is expected of them. Antonyms for this phrase would be someone who follows the rules or acts in a socially acceptable manner. Other antonyms could include conformity, obedience, compliance, submission, or abiding by the rules.
